Transaction 07fd63f1bfb307141c024ab860841b6e7af7df830a91fce7870e6e3ba29dcf8a
1 Input
2 Outputs
- 07fd63f1bfb307141c024ab860841b6e7af7df830a91fce7870e6e3ba29dcf8a:0
- 07fd63f1bfb307141c024ab860841b6e7af7df830a91fce7870e6e3ba29dcf8a:1
value 40907514
address 3EEncxsiAwFhaWg4bAvTUdQjRpn2pFp63j
value 2293830
address 36uya2X7CWCuhDQ7FhZM1bG9DphW2qmc2m